文章详情

专注互联网科技,赋能企业数字化发展

2025年代码粘贴进Word全攻略:从新手到高手的避坑指南

兄弟们,是不是每次写毕业论文、技术报告或者软著文档的时候,都被“怎么把代码优雅地放进Word”这个问题整得头皮发麻?直接Ctrl+C/V吧,格式乱成一锅粥;截图吧,又不能复制,导师看了直摇头。别慌!这篇超硬核保姆级教程,就带你用最接地气的方式,把代码整得明明白白、漂漂亮亮,让你的文档瞬间提升好几个档次!

一、核心功能大拆解:Word里放代码到底有几种神操作?

首先咱得搞清楚,往Word里塞代码,可不是只有“复制粘贴”这一条土路。根据你的需求和场景,主流方法能分好几派,各有各的绝活。

第一种是“懒人必备”的原生插入法。打开Word,点“插入”->“对象”->“文件中的文字”,然后选中你的.py或.cpp源文件,一键导入。这招对付大文件特别香,比如你有个上千行的算法,手动复制累死,用这招秒搞定,而且能完美保留原始缩进和换行。但缺点也很明显,就是纯文本,黑乎乎一片,没有高亮,看起来有点费眼睛。

第二种是“颜值党”的最爱——高亮插件流。在VS Code里装个“Polacode”或者“CodeSnap”,选中代码一键生成带主题、带阴影的高清图片,直接拖进Word,那叫一个赏心悦目!适合放在PPT或者需要展示的场合。不过,图片不能编辑,万一有个小bug要改,就得回IDE重做,有点麻烦。另一种更高级的是装“Copy Syntax Highlight”这类插件,它能把代码复制成带颜色信息的RTF富文本,粘贴到Word里就是彩色的,还能直接编辑,简直是YYDS!

第三种是“技术宅”的终极武器——Python自动化。用python-docx库写个脚本,不仅能自动读取代码文件,还能结合Pygments语法高亮引擎,生成带颜色的.docx文档。想象一下,你点一下运行,几十个代码文件自动生成一份排版精美的技术手册,效率直接拉满。这种方法虽然前期要写点代码,但一旦配置好,以后就是躺赢模式。

举个栗子,小A同学写课程设计报告,直接用原生插入法,5分钟搞定;而小B同学要做项目答辩,用Polacode生成了赛博朋克风的代码图,评委老师眼前一亮,直接加分。选择哪种方法,完全看你想要啥效果!

二、不同价位方案横评:免费、付费、自己动手,哪个最香?

说到成本,咱也得盘一盘。毕竟不是人人都愿意为了个代码高亮去氪金的。

零成本方案绝对是学生党的首选。前面说的原生插入法、VS Code自带的插件(大部分免费)、以及用Python写脚本,都是0花费。特别是Python方案,只要你有编程基础,网上开源代码一搜一大把,改改就能用。数据上来看,根据2025年的开发者社区调查,超过78%的学生和技术博主都依赖这些免费工具来处理日常文档。

轻度付费方案主要是一些Word插件,比如“Easy Syntax Highlighter”。这类插件通常在Office应用商店里,有些免费但带水印,付费解锁完整功能也就几十块钱。它的优势是开箱即用,不用折腾代码,在Word里点几下就能高亮,对非技术背景的同学非常友好。但缺点是灵活性差,配色和字体选项有限,可能不符合你的审美。

重度玩家方案就是自己撸代码了。虽然不花钱买软件,但花的是时间和脑细胞。不过,一旦你掌握了python-docx+Pygments这套组合拳,你就拥有了无限的可能性。你可以自定义任何配色方案,批量处理成百上千个文件,甚至集成到你的CI/CD流程里。从长期ROI(投资回报率)来看,这绝对是最划算的。对比一下,手动处理100个文件可能要一天,而脚本跑完只要5分钟,这时间差,够你多睡几觉了!

三、真实场景大测试:毕业论文、软著申请、技术博客怎么搞?

光说不练假把式,咱们放到真实场景里遛一遛。

场景一:毕业设计/课程报告。这是最常见的需求。导师通常要求代码可复制、格式清晰。这时候,强烈推荐用“原生插入法”+“手动样式调整”。先把代码插进去,然后全选,字体换成Consolas或Courier New(等宽字体是代码的灵魂!),字号10.5,再加个灰色底纹,瞬间专业感爆棚。整个过程不超过10分钟,效果却比瞎粘贴强一百倍。千万别用截图,导师想查你有没有抄袭都无从下手。

场景二:软件著作权申请。软著材料对代码格式要求极其严格,必须是纯文本、无高亮、行号清晰。这时候,任何带颜色的方案都得靠边站。最佳实践是:用Notepad++打开源码,确保编码是UTF-8无BOM,然后全选复制,粘贴到一个全新的Word文档里。接着,在Word里设置段落,取消所有自动编号和项目符号,确保每一行都是干净的。有同学图省事用了高亮插件,结果被版权局打回来重做,白白耽误一周时间,血泪教训啊!

场景三:技术博客/公众号配图。这里追求的是视觉冲击力。用Carbon.now.sh这个在线神器,粘贴代码,选个炫酷的主题(比如“Dracula”或“One Dark”),加个窗口边框,导出PNG。这种图片发到社交平台,点赞量都比普通截图高。数据显示,带精美代码图的技术文章,平均阅读完成率比纯文字高出35%。因为好看的东西,大家才愿意看下去嘛!

四、常见误区大扫雷:这些坑99%的人都踩过!

好了,现在来说说那些让人抓狂的误区,帮你绕开雷区。

误区一:“直接从IDE复制就行”。大错特错!IDE里的代码带着一堆隐藏的HTML标签和CSS样式,粘贴到Word里,Word会用自己的逻辑去解析,结果就是缩进没了、空格变制表符、引号变成中文弯引号。正确的姿势是:先粘贴到记事本(Notepad)里“洗一遍”,去掉所有格式,再从记事本复制到Word。这一步能解决80%的格式问题。

误区二:“高亮越花哨越好”。不是的!在正式文档里,过于鲜艳的颜色反而会分散读者注意力。学术圈和工业界普遍接受的是简洁、低对比度的配色,比如GitHub的默认主题。那种荧光绿配亮粉色的“彩虹屁”风格,只适合个人笔记,千万别用在正经场合。

误区三:“Python脚本能搞定一切”。python-docx确实强大,但它有个致命弱点:它本身不支持语法高亮。很多人以为装了这个库就能自动高亮,结果发现代码还是黑白的。真相是,你必须搭配Pygments这样的词法分析器,把代码解析成一个个带颜色标记的片段,再逐个写入Word。这个过程稍微复杂,但网上有成熟的封装方案,照着抄作业就行。

五、选购与避坑技巧:工具太多怎么选?记住这几点就够了!

面对琳琅满目的插件和工具,怎么选才不踩坑?记住这几个黄金法则。

第一,看兼容性。2025年了,很多老插件已经不维护了。安装前先看一眼最后更新日期,如果是2023年之前的,大概率和新版VS Code或Word不兼容。优先选择官方市场里评分4.5以上、周下载量过万的插件。

第二,看输出格式。你需要的是可编辑的文本,还是不可编辑的图片?如果是为了存档或打印,图片无妨;但如果是为了协作或后续修改,必须选能输出富文本(RTF/HTML)的工具。像“Copy Syntax Highlight”就明确说明输出RTF,完美适配Word。

第三,看学习成本。如果你只是偶尔用一次,就别折腾Python脚本了,直接用现成的在线工具,比如PlanetB或Carbon。它们的UI做得贼简单,粘贴、点按钮、复制,三步搞定。把精力省下来,干点更有价值的事,不香吗?

六、未来趋势展望:AI和云原生会如何改变这一切?

最后,咱们把眼光放长远点,看看未来的风向在哪。

趋势一:AI智能格式化。已经有AI工具能自动识别你粘贴的代码,并为其匹配最佳的Word样式。你只需要Ctrl+V,剩下的交给AI。它会自动选字体、调行距、加底纹,甚至能根据上下文判断是否需要高亮。这在未来1-2年内可能会成为标配。

趋势二:云原生协作。随着Office 365和Google Docs的普及,未来的代码插入可能会直接在云端完成。想象一下,在VS Code里写完代码,右键“Share to Word Online”,代码就带着高亮出现在你的共享文档里,队友可以实时评论。这种无缝体验,才是真正的生产力革命。

趋势三:标准化输出。业界可能会推动一种新的标准格式,专门用于在富文本文档中嵌入代码。这样,无论你用什么编辑器、什么平台,代码都能以统一、保真的方式呈现。这将彻底终结我们今天面临的各种兼容性问题。

总之,把代码放进Word,看似是个小问题,背后却藏着大学问。掌握这些技巧,不仅能让你的文档更专业,更能大大提升你的工作效率。赶紧收藏这篇干货,下次写文档时,直接照着抄作业,让代码成为你文档里的亮点,而不是痛点!

返回新闻列表